标签: ios objective-c cocoa-touch uiimageview
非常简单的问题。 UIViewContentModeScaleAspectFit始终将UIImageView在其框架中垂直或水平居中。有可能抵消吗?
答案 0 :(得分:0)
说它在垂直中心对齐,我可能想要它在垂直顶部。它仍然适合它的方面。
实现此目的的最简单方法是为图像视图使用容器视图,并在容器中移动图像视图。
您仍然需要对图像进行纵横比拟,但是根据图像本身的纵横比以及适合它的框架的大小,您需要一些额外的逻辑来更改图像视图的框架。您可以从图像的size属性中获取此信息。
size